Kiss My Gritz is a Southern breakfast and brunch cafe, known for its hearty grits-based dishes, classic comfort food, and a welcoming, community-driven atmosphere. Features menu items such as shrimp & grits, southern seafood dishes, and delicious chicken and waffle options. They’re known for their fresh, savory flavors as well as their inviting, friendly customer service, conveniently located off Exit 61 in Fairburn, Georgia— perfect for travelers and locals alike.
